Transaction 9388427af2d87aacb21d436e194acd34e75cf463ec823729edd3a72f52e4996d
1 Input
1 Output
-
9388427af2d87aacb21d436e194acd34e75cf463ec823729edd3a72f52e4996d:0
- value
- 11113774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cab95c5edde9cb67fb9ddf256c1b0d648282f67f OP_EQUAL
- address
- 3LAvUPXe8h4f3DSiABDzG4DURAZA4qxGko